The Medical Guide Wire is commonly used in hospitals and clinics during various medical procedures such as angioplasty, stenting, and embolization. It is designed to navigate through the arteries and veins of the human body with ease, providing an accurate and precise pathway for other medical devices to follow.
The Medical Guide Wire is compatible with MRI and CT scanning machines, which makes it an ideal device for medical procedures that require imaging. The high flexibility of the Medical Guide Wire allows it to be bent and twisted without breaking, making it a reliable device during medical procedures.
